Output 668e7fc62b3c8e7af2600da2bdaf0f2b4e84f70b00893c3e334671753264c47a:14

value
29849998
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14b733987fefb3a09757f50db2c5592811486869 OP_EQUALVERIFY OP_CHECKSIG
address
12tXyuPEM3VG79VeE1vGabTBRaN4JJrdtu
transaction
668e7fc62b3c8e7af2600da2bdaf0f2b4e84f70b00893c3e334671753264c47a
confirmations
151943
spent
true